Gemini表面活性剂的缓蚀性研究
Absorption and corrosion Inhibition Performances of Gemini Surfactant in Saturated H2S/CO2 medium
【摘要】 通过失重法和电化学测试方法研究了在50℃时饱和H2S/CO2介质中季铵盐类12-s-12(s=2,3,4,5和6)型Gemini表面活性剂对Cr13钢的吸附缓蚀性能及其机理。结果表明:50℃时Gemini表面活性剂在饱和H2S/CO2介质中对Cr13钢具有较好的缓蚀效果,其中12-6-12型Gemini表面活性剂的缓蚀性能最佳,缓蚀率能达到90%以上。研究得出间隔基变化对表面活性剂缓蚀性能的影响规律,用电化学极化曲线法和交流阻抗谱图讨论了这种规律的作用机理。12-s-12型Gemini表面活性剂为阴极型缓蚀剂。
【Abstract】 Adsorption and corrosion inhibition performances of steel quaternary ammonium salt type Gemini surfactants 12-S-12(s= 2,3,4,5,6) on Gr13 steel in saturated H2S/CO2 medium at 50℃.were studied using weight loss and electrochemical test methods. The results revealed that the Gemini surfactants were excellent inhibitors for Cr13 steel protection in saturated H2S/CO2 medium at 50℃,in which 12-6-12-type Gemini surfactant offered best performance and its inhibition efficiency was above 90%.The law of impact of interval-based changes on the surfactant’s corrosion inhibition performance was found in the study,and electrochemical polarization curves and electrochemical impedance spectroscopy were used to discuss the mechanism of the law.12-s-12-type Gemini surfactants were a cathode corrosion inhibitor.
